The Basic Principles Of Database Optimization
The Basic Principles Of Database Optimization
Blog Article
Principal Keys: Uniquely identify Every row inside a table, much like how mathematical relations avoid replicate entries.
A Primary Crucial uniquely identifies Every tuple inside a relation. It need to contain special values and can't have NULL values. Case in point: ROLL_NO in the coed desk is the primary essential.
Having said that, you may want to create tables with a one:1 marriage less than a certain set of instances. In case you have a discipline with optional information, like “description,” that may be blank for most of the documents, you'll be able to move all of the descriptions into their very own desk, eliminating vacant Room and enhancing database performance.
This comprehensive guide is designed to equip you Using the information and tools to build a relational database. We’ll outline the technological facets of making tables, defining relationships, and querying info and likewise examine the theoretical foundations of relational database design.
The development of databases is significantly dependent on the appliance of machine Mastering. Machine Mastering procedures can be used to establish patterns in knowledge, produce predictions, and automate information-relevant tasks.
Each the revenue and merchandise tables would've a 1:M relationship with sold_products. This kind of go-involving entity known as a backlink table, associative entity, or junction table in many designs.
The first usual kind (abbreviated as 1NF) specifies that each cell in the table can have just one worth, hardly ever a list of values, so a table like this doesn't comply:
Considering that the relational database recognizes that there's a partnership between shipping and delivery information and facts and stock, You should utilize your essential to accessibility stock figures and transport requests to match facts.
Given that 2006, we’ve brought our information engineering and management knowledge to companies in almost each and every field possible.
With all the ideas in position, it’s time and energy to build! This stage entails making the database applying a selected DBMS and populating it along with your actual details. Consider the construction crews erecting the library partitions, putting in shelves, and punctiliously inserting the publications on them.
A relational database is often a type of database that organizes information into tables with rows and columns and establishes interactions in between these tables depending on Custom Database Design & Development popular fields. It’s significant for organizations mainly because it offers a structured and successful strategy to retailer, deal with, and retrieve facts.
Designing a database the best way needs some Examination of one's information and planning all over how you should construction it. You will find many alternative database sorts, designs, and customizations you can use to attain your plans.
“These men are legitimate experts, We Build Databases solved our complex complications and helped us make our have market software program Remedy.”
What’s The easiest way to start off mapping my current database framework in Lucidchart while not having to start out from scratch?